The video explains SPF (Sun Protection Factor), highlighting its limitations and how it only measures UVB protection, not UVA. It discusses the flawed testing methods using human volunteers and the real-world implications of these tests. The video suggests that consistent sunscreen use, even with low SPF, reduces skin cancer risk. Future improvements in SPF testing include using robots and in vitro methods for more accurate results.
